We loved the fact they name certain ingredients such as Kevin the Bergamot Fruit and their stills are called Juliet and her \u2018big sister\u2019 Ophelia.<\/p>\n<p>The history of the Silent Pool is so interesting too. Dating back to Pagan times when women (or witches &#8211; as they believed at the time) were sacrificed in the clear, 6-degree waters. A dredging of the Pool in the 1900\u2019s came up with hundreds of items of jewellery and artefacts proving this.<\/p>\n<p>When it gets really interesting is around the time of Richard The Lionheart and the legend of Robin Hood in approximately 1160. A young nobleman called John lived on the land surrounding Albury. He used to hunt in the forests and take the riches of the locals. A young girl called Emma, the Woodcutter\u2019s Daughter, used to bathe in the Silent Pool every day and was seen by John who tried to attack her one afternoon. Instead of giving up her modesty, Emma crept further into the pool to hide from him and was sucked under. She sadly drowned trying to escape him.<\/p>\n<p>A few years later, John was crowned King of England following the death of his older brother Richard The Lionheart, and John\u2019s reign of terror started. He has been known throughout history as one of the worst and most evil of Kings. The death of Emma spurred the myth of the Silent Pool even further. Since that fateful day when she innocently went swimming, many people have been to the Silent Pool to try and end their lives in the honourable way Emma did. Innocent and free, rather than be subjected to evil and shame.<\/p>\n<p>It wasn\u2019t until respected author Agatha Christie went missing in 1926 that the legend of the Silent Pool resurfaced in the public eye. When Agatha found out her husband Archie was having an affair and was planning to leave her, she abandoned her car near the Silent Pool and disappeared for 13 days. Everyone thought she was dead although she had actually checked into a spa under Archie\u2019s mistresses name in Harrogate! Funny? No. As the whole country suspected at the time of her disappearance that Archie had murdered her. It was then the tables turned on Agatha when the truth of her whereabouts came out. She was castigated by the nation for \u2018setting up\u2019 Archie.<\/p>\n<p>So again, the Pool got even more press. It was definitely becoming somewhat of a national treasure. To this day the Silent Pool is considered by locals to have special powers and definitely has an eeriness about it. During the tour there were several guests noticeably getting chills down their spine as the talks progressed. It is green to look at with so much moss and foliage at its side. We saw at least 100 turquoise dragonflies circling the pool. The same beautiful colour that is on their famous bottles interestingly. The fact that this site is steeped in so much history and legend is an honour to Surrey and the Silent Pool Gin founders that have kept it in its natural state.<\/p>\n<p>&nbsp;<\/p>\n<p>&nbsp;<\/p>\n<p>ENTREPRENEURS CARRY ON THE LEGEND<\/p>\n<p>So how did the brand come about? Well, in 2014, Silent Pool Gin founders Ian McCulloch and James Shelbourne met in their local pub (where else?!) and discussed the idea of setting up a distillery. The duo started out with a grand vision of making it next to a fresh water source, producing handcrafted, artisan spirits using locally sourced ingredients.<\/p>\n<p>But first they needed the perfect location. Most distilleries end up in grim locations or boring industrial estates. Ian and James wanted somewhere filled with history, a good story and plenty of provenance. After scouting many locations in the south of England, one day Ian discovered Sherbourne Farm on the banks of the Silent Pool. Excited by the find, Ian and James contacted the landowner, The Duke of Northumberland, and got the go ahead to restore the dilapidated farm buildings into the Silent Pool Distillery.<\/p>\n<p>And the rest as they say is history. Thanks Ian and James! Silent Pool Gin is considered one of the UK\u2019s most famous gins and exports around the world to hundreds of countries producing a staggering 45,000 bottles a year. We recommend getting a cab!<\/p>\n<p>What makes Silent Pool Gin so unique and flavoursome is down to their delicious recipe with a selection of botanicals including Bosnian juniper berries, liquorice root, cassia bark, orris and bergamot (or Kevin!) which are then bruised and macerated in spirit before being transferred to the still. As Paul was explaining the process, we were able to smell the core ingredients that go into the gin. Heavenly&#8230; especially the bitter orange. These key ingredients are what give Silent Pool Gin its unique depth and flavour.<\/p>\n<p>We also discovered their unique four-stage process allows the distillers to precisely control the quality and flavour of the gin. Interestingly, after the third distilling process, the gin comes out as 86% proof but when mixed with the purified Silent Pool water it drops down to its final 43% volume.<\/p>\n<p>Then we were able to see the gin basket infusion, which hangs in the neck of their Holstein still. Fresh orange and lime peel, dried pears, Macedonian Juniper and Polish Angelica &#8211; to name but a few, lift the spirit with bright aromatics and citrus notes. The more delicate botanicals such as rose petals, kaffir lime leaves, linden and elderflower are separately macerated in a process that is called the \u2018Gin Tea Infusion\u2019, stripping the oils and aromatic compounds from the vegetal matter. This is strained and added to the pot, which lend the gin its ethereal high notes of perfumed lime and floral essence. The distillation process is completed using a multi-chambered fractioning column and through precise control over a series of plates and cooling pipes finally balancing the spirit, ready to be packaged and sent.<\/p>\n<p>&nbsp;<\/p>\n<p>GINTASTIC OPTIONS<\/p>\n<p>SILENT POOL GIN (ORIGINAL)<\/p>\n<p>Luxury English gin handcrafted with 24 botanicals in the Surrey Hills.
